Você já está trabalhando com modelos de inteligência artificial e quer levar seu projeto para o próximo nível?
O fine-tuning pode ser a chave para aprimorar o desempenho dos seus modelos e torná-los mais eficazes para tarefas específicas.
Aqui estão algumas dicas valiosas para te ajudar a refinar suas habilidades de fine-tuning e obter resultados impressionantes!
1. Escolha o Modelo Pré-Treinado Adequado
Antes de começar o fine-tuning, escolha um modelo pré-treinado que seja relevante para sua tarefa. Modelos como BERT para processamento de linguagem natural ou ResNet para visão computacional são excelentes pontos de partida. A escolha do modelo certo pode economizar muito tempo e esforço.
2. Prepare Dados de Treinamento de Alta Qualidade
A qualidade dos dados é crucial. Certifique-se de que seu conjunto de dados de treinamento é limpo, relevante e representativo da tarefa específica. Dados bem anotados e balanceados ajudam o modelo a aprender de maneira mais eficaz e evitar problemas como overfitting.
3. Ajuste Hiperparâmetros com Cuidado
Os hiperparâmetros, como a taxa de aprendizado, o número de épocas e o tamanho do lote, desempenham um papel importante no fine-tuning. Experimente diferentes configurações e use técnicas como a busca em grid ou a busca aleatória para encontrar a combinação ideal.
4. Use Regularização para Evitar Overfitting
O fine-tuning pode levar ao overfitting se o modelo se ajustar demais aos dados de treinamento. Para evitar isso, utilize técnicas de regularização como dropout, L2 regularization, e early stopping. Essas práticas ajudam a melhorar a generalização do modelo.
5. Monitoramento e Validação Contínuos
Monitore o desempenho do seu modelo em um conjunto de validação durante o processo de fine-tuning. Isso permite detectar problemas cedo e ajustar os parâmetros conforme necessário. O uso de métricas apropriadas (como acurácia, F1-score, etc.) é essencial para avaliar a performance.
6. Experimente Combinando Modelos
Não tenha medo de experimentar combinações de modelos ou técnicas diferentes. Às vezes, combinar várias abordagens ou ajustar o modelo em camadas específicas pode levar a melhorias significativas na performance.
7. Treine em Menos Dados se Necessário
Se você está trabalhando com um número limitado de dados, considere técnicas como data augmentation ou transfer learning. Essas abordagens podem ajudar a maximizar o aprendizado do modelo sem a necessidade de grandes quantidades de dados.
8. Documente Suas Experiências
Mantenha um registro detalhado das suas experimentações com diferentes configurações e resultados. Documentar suas descobertas pode economizar tempo em projetos futuros e ajudar a entender o impacto das suas escolhas.
9. Utilize Recursos da Comunidade
Participe de fóruns, grupos de discussão e consulte a documentação dos frameworks que está utilizando. A comunidade pode oferecer insights valiosos e soluções para desafios comuns no fine-tuning.
10. Continue Aprendendo e Evoluindo
O campo da IA está sempre evoluindo, com novas técnicas e melhores práticas surgindo constantemente. Mantenha-se atualizado com as últimas pesquisas e tendências para refinar continuamente suas habilidades e conhecimentos.
Pronto para Ajustar Seu Modelo?
Com essas dicas, você estará no caminho certo para melhorar o desempenho dos seus modelos de IA e alcançar resultados excepcionais.
O fine-tuning é uma arte que combina conhecimento técnico com criatividade. Experimente, ajuste e veja a mágica acontecer!